Ollabelle

music

Ollabelle is a New York based quintet who draw from a deep well of gospel, blues, bluegrass, and country influences to create a timelessly resonant music that honors the integrity of its sources while remaining effortlessly contemporary.  A multitalented collective whose participants share vocal and songwriting duties, Ollabelle gains strength from its members’ shared sense of mission, as well as their diverse musical and personal backgrounds.  Ollabelle is Amy Helm (vocal, mandola), Byron Isaacs (vocal, bass, dobro), Tony Leone (vocal, drums, percussion), Fiona McBain (vocal, acoustic/electric guitar), and Glenn Patscha (vocal, keyboards, accordion).
